Duties and Responsibilities:
· Plan, execute, and document penetration tests across web, mobile, cloud, and infrastructure environments.
· Design and perform penetration tests to simulate cyber attacks
· Design and implement reusable pen-testing tools and frameworks to support the wider security team.
· Conduct advanced offensive security operations simulating real-world adversary tactics, techniques, and procedures (TTPs).
· Stay current on emerging threats, malware trends, and new exploitation techniques.
· Collaborate with developers, system administrators, and project teams to improve overall security posture.
· Perform post-exploitation analysis and demonstrate potential business impact of identified vulnerabilities.
· Assist in developing security awareness initiatives, including simulated phishing and social engineering campaigns.
· Contribute to the enhancement of internal security processes, playbooks, and knowledge repositories.
· Support compliance and regulatory security testing requirements (e.g., PCI-DSS, ISO 27001, GDPR).
· Engage in red team and purple team exercises, working alongside defensive security teams to validate detection and response capabilities.
Skills Required:
· Proven experience in penetration testing, vulnerability analysis, and threat modeling.
· Strong understanding of OWASP, PTES, and other standard penetration testing methodologies.
· Hands-on experience in testing web and mobile applications, networks, and cloud infrastructure.
· Experience with scripting languages (Python, JavaScript, etc.).
· Solid knowledge of Windows, Linux, and networking fundamentals.
· Familiarity with cloud security controls and penetration testing in cloud environments (AWS/Azure/GCP).
· Experience in designing and executing social engineering assessments.
·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with the ability to explain technical findings to both technical and non-technical audiences.
·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
